Download cyborg cockroaches are here shorts technology innovation

Duration: (25) 2025-02-10T14:46:52+00:00



cyborg cockroaches are here shorts technology innovation cyborg cockroaches are here shorts technology innovation cyborg cockroaches are here shorts technology innovation

Description
Download this and online watch cyborg cockroaches are here shorts technology innovation
Related videos

Mxtube.net